This was a recipe I found in one of my moms cooking recipes. It turned out very well.


The first thing you do is start the noodles, about 2 cups, and cook them like normal.  While those cook in a separate pot you cook two cloves of crushed garlic and 1/4 cup butter.  Once melted you add 1/4 cup flour, l tablespoon of grounded mustard, and salt and pepper to taste. Mix till smooth blend in 2 1/2 cups milk, 3/4 cup beer, and 1/4 cup half and half.  cook till boiling and thick.  Once thick add 2 cups cheddar and 2 cups mozzarella. once cheese has melted add cooked noodles(make sure to drain water) put in greased casserole pan. Sprinkle 1 cup cheddar cheese and 3 table spoon Parmesan on top. Place in oven at 400 degrees for about 20 minutes. and done.

Now that's how I made it the original want bacon on top, some fontina cheese, and Heavy whipping cream, but I had to improvise. I have to say both me and my mother enjoyed the recipe. I'd only recommend this though if you like beer. My mom said all she could taste was the garlic, while all I could taste was the beer. It was delicious though and I'd have to rate this a 6 out of 10. The only reason I rate it low, is because I probably won't make this again.
